The music industry sucked up most of the red carpet oxygen this weekend, what with the Grammys and their various pre- and post-parties (coverage of which we’ve only begun to serve up). But the entertainment industry soldiered on in other areas and there’s an Oscars race hitting fever pitch. All the more reason for nominee and this year’s Golden Girl, Miss Margot, to put on a fun frock and go take a hometown-flavored victory lap in the spotlight:
And y’know? That really is a cute getup. And we say this as people inclined to HATE paperbag waistbands. And also as people who do not particularly love rose florals on white backgrounds because they look like a home textile; bedsheet, shower curtain – you name it. But it’s bright and fun and has the kind of retro shape that she tends to be good at working. And we’re kind of loving the massive rings. They look like Barbie jewelry.
She looks fresh, confident and relaxed. Despite our dislike of this kind of print, it really works for her here.
Style Credits:
Zimmermann Golden Floral Shirt and Golden Plissé Skirt from the Spring 2018 Collection
David Webb Jewelry
